Management of Subtherapeutic Valproic Acid Level (44 µg/mL) on Divalproex 500 mg Twice Daily

Your valproic acid level of 44 µg/mL is below the therapeutic range of 50-100 µg/mL, and you need an immediate dose increase to prevent breakthrough seizures and reduce morbidity and mortality risk. 1, 2

Immediate Dose Adjustment Strategy

Increase your oral divalproex dose by 5-10 mg/kg per week until achieving therapeutic levels of 50-100 µg/mL. 1 For most adults, this translates to:

  • Increase from 1000 mg/day (500 mg twice daily) to 1250-1500 mg/day as the next step 1
  • Continue weekly increases of 250-500 mg/day until therapeutic levels are reached 1
  • Target total daily dose typically ranges from 1500-3000 mg/day for most adults with epilepsy 1

Critical Monitoring Parameters

  • Recheck valproic acid trough level 3-5 days after each dose adjustment to guide further titration 3
  • Ensure blood samples are drawn as true trough levels (immediately before the morning dose) because timing significantly impacts interpretation—samples drawn 12-15 hours after an evening dose will read 18-25% higher than true trough 3
  • Monitor for thrombocytopenia risk, which increases significantly at trough levels above 110 µg/mL in females and 135 µg/mL in males 1

Common Pitfalls to Avoid

Before assuming treatment failure, verify medication adherence—non-compliance is the most common cause of subtherapeutic levels and breakthrough seizures. 4 Specifically ask about:

  • Missed doses in the past week
  • Whether the patient is taking generic versus brand formulations (bioavailability can differ)
  • Recent addition of enzyme-inducing medications

Check for drug interactions that dramatically lower valproic acid levels: 4, 5

  • Carbapenems (meropenem, imipenem, ertapenem) can precipitate breakthrough seizures by reducing valproate levels by 60-100%—these antibiotics are absolutely contraindicated with valproate 4
  • Enzyme-inducing antiepileptics (phenytoin, carbamazepine, phenobarbital) may require higher valproate doses 1

When to Consider IV Loading

Reserve IV valproate loading (20-30 mg/kg over 5-20 minutes) only for status epilepticus, not for a single breakthrough seizure or subtherapeutic level discovered on routine monitoring. 6, 4, 5 For your situation with an isolated low level:

  • Oral dose escalation is appropriate and safer 4
  • IV loading carries an 88% efficacy for acute seizures but is unnecessary when the patient is clinically stable 6, 5

Special Considerations

  • The often-quoted therapeutic range of 50-100 µg/mL must be interpreted with caution because large diurnal fluctuations occur with valproate's short half-life, and some patients achieve seizure control at lower or higher concentrations 2, 7
  • Adverse reactions increase significantly above 100 µg/mL, including hyperammonemia (even with normal liver function) and thrombocytopenia 2, 8
  • Elderly patients are at higher risk for valproate-induced hyperammonemia and thrombocytopenia, even at therapeutic concentrations—monitor ammonia levels and platelet counts if confusion or weakness develops 8

Dosing Algorithm Summary

  1. Increase divalproex to 1250-1500 mg/day (split into 2-3 divided doses if total exceeds 250 mg) 1
  2. Recheck trough level in 3-5 days (before morning dose) 3
  3. If level remains <50 µg/mL, increase by another 250-500 mg/day 1
  4. Repeat cycle until level reaches 50-100 µg/mL 1
  5. Maximum recommended dose is 60 mg/kg/day (approximately 4200 mg/day for a 70 kg adult), though some patients may require higher doses 1, 9
